/*jslint node: true */ 'use strict'; const { getPoolState, getSwapParams } = require('oswap-v2-sdk'); const { isValidAddress } = require('obyte/lib/utils'); const { getEnvironment } = require("./environment.js"); const { getObyteClient } = require("./obyte-client.js"); const oswap_factory_aas = { testnet: 'OQLU4HOAIVJ32SDVBJA6AKD52OVTHAOF', mainnet: 'OQLU4HOAIVJ32SDVBJA6AKD52OVTHAOF', }; let poolParams = {}; let cachedPoolsByPair = {}; const pools_by_pair_cache_timeout = 24 * 3600 * 1000; // 24 hours let cachedPoolVars = {}; const pool_vars_cache_timeout = 5 * 60 * 1000; // 5 min /** * Find an Oswap pool that connects `from_asset` and `to_asset` * @memberOf counterstake-sdk * @param {string} from_asset * @param {string} to_asset * @param {boolean} testnet * @param {Object} obyteClient * @return {Promise<?string>} * @example * const pool = await findOswapPool(from_asset, to_asset, testnet, obyteClient); */ async function findOswapPool(from_asset, to_asset, testnet, obyteClient) { if (!from_asset || !to_asset) throw Error("from_asset or to_asset isn't valid"); const pair = from_asset > to_asset ? from_asset + '_' + to_asset : to_asset + '_' + from_asset; if (cachedPoolsByPair[pair] && cachedPoolsByPair[pair].ts > Date.now() - pools_by_pair_cache_timeout) return cachedPoolsByPair[pair].pool; const client = obyteClient || getObyteClient(testnet); const var_prefix = 'pool_'; const vars = await client.api.getAaStateVars({ address: oswap_factory_aas[getEnvironment(testnet)], var_prefix }); let pools = []; for (let var_name in vars) { const pool = var_name.substring(var_prefix.length); const { x_asset, y_asset } = vars[var_name]; if (x_asset === from_asset && y_asset === to_asset || x_asset === to_asset && y_asset === from_asset) pools.push(pool); } console.log(`oswap pools for ${from_asset} to ${to_asset}`, pools); if (pools.length === 0) return null; let best_pool; if (pools.length === 1) { best_pool = pools[0]; } else { // find the pool with most liquidity const balances = await client.api.getBalances(pools); let max_balance_from = 0; for (let pool of pools) { const balance = balances[pool][from_asset] ? balances[pool][from_asset].total : 0; if (balance > max_balance_from) { max_balance_from = balance; best_pool = pool; } } // best_pool can stay undefined if all pools are empty } if (best_pool) { cachedPoolsByPair[pair] = { pool: best_pool, ts: Date.now(), }; } return best_pool; } async function getPoolParams(pool, testnet, obyteClient) { if (typeof pool !== "string" || !isValidAddress(pool)) throw Error("pool isn't valid") if (!poolParams[pool]) { const client = obyteClient || getObyteClient(testnet); const definition = await client.api.getDefinition(pool); const { params } = definition[1]; poolParams[pool] = params; } return poolParams[pool]; } async function getPoolVars(pool, testnet, obyteClient) { if (typeof pool !== "string" || !isValidAddress(pool)) throw Error("pool isn't valid") if (cachedPoolVars[pool] && cachedPoolVars[pool].ts > Date.now() - pool_vars_cache_timeout) return cachedPoolVars[pool].vars; const client = obyteClient || getObyteClient(testnet); const vars = await client.api.getAaStateVars({ address: pool, var_prefix: ''}); cachedPoolVars[pool] = { vars, ts: Date.now() }; return vars; } /** * Get the output amount from swapping `in_asset` through `pool` * @memberOf counterstake-sdk * @param {string} pool * @param {number} in_amount_in_pennies * @param {string} in_asset * @param {boolean} testnet * @param {Object} obyteClient * @return {Promise<number>} * @example * const out_amount_in_pennies = await getOswapOutput(pool, in_amount_in_pennies, in_asset, testnet, obyteClient); */ async function getOswapOutput(pool, in_amount_in_pennies, in_asset, testnet, obyteClient) { const params = await getPoolParams(pool, testnet, obyteClient); const stateVars = await getPoolVars(pool, testnet, obyteClient); const poolState = getPoolState(params, stateVars); const swapParams = getSwapParams(in_amount_in_pennies, in_asset, poolState); const { res, delta_Yn } = swapParams; const net_amount_out = res.net_amount_X; return net_amount_out; } exports.findOswapPool = findOswapPool; exports.getOswapOutput = getOswapOutput;
